Why I stopped eating Amala, other heavy Nigerian dishes…

Share:

Nigerian rapper Olamide says he has cut out traditional heavy meals like Amala in favour of lighter, healthier options to maintain energy.

Nigerian rap legend Olamide has revealed a significant dietary shift, saying he no longer eats traditional heavy meals like Amala. In a YouTube interview with Korty EO released Sunday, August 3, the YBNL boss said such dishes often left him feeling sluggish.

“I don’t eat Amala, it makes me full,” he said. “I’m not a big fan of food. I eat veggies. But I can kill for broccoli. I love broccoli, sea bass fish, lamb chops, and even caviar.”

Olamide added that the change supports his health goals and helps him stay active and energised.
